Siebel Integration Developer (3154)
DescriptionSiebel Integration Developer will provide technical design and development for our CRM implementation, including integration & customization. This senior level position will provide technical direction and hands-on development & integration work, working closely with our vendor partners.D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ES: Work with vendor partners to provide best-practice assurance across package utilization, customizations, integration, maintainability, etc. Design & develop CRM interfaces via EIA & EIM components Ensure comprehensive unit testing, app level alerting, error handling, etc. are in place for CRM Work closely with peer development, QA, operations, etc. teams to ensure close communication & successful testing, deployment, issue resolution Post-production development support Required Skills Strong configuration knowledge - Siebel Tools, Workflow, EIA, EIM, Integatrion Tools (WAS, MQ Series BEA, SeeBeyond, Fusion, etc.), eScript, VB Script, Business Services Intermediate level proficiency with Microsoft Word, Excel and Outlook. Intermediate level proficiency with Java, OOP and HTML programming languages. Expert level proficiency with Oracle databases. Intermediate level proficiency with VSS and CVS. Basic level proficiency with Windows NT and Linux (RedHat, SUSE, Debian) servers. Intermediate level proficiency with Windows and Linux operating systems. Excellent oral and written communication; interpersonal skills Excellent analytical, research and problem solving skills Strong mathematical aptitude Required Experience 2-4 years of Siebel integration development experience required 2-4 years of CRM package development, integration, maintenance required 7+ yrs experience working in an Information systems role Bachelor's degree and experience in an IT related field required Seibel 7 or 8 Core Consultant Certifications preferredScottrade, Inc., an equal opportunity employer, is committed to inclusion and a diverse workforce.
